Step 1: Assessment and Planning
We’ll assess the damage and create a customized plan to restore your office building. Our team will identify the source of the water damage and develop a strategy to address it. Within 60 minutes, we’ll have a clear plan in place to get your business back up and running.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Our team will use advanced equipment to extract water from your office building, reducing the risk of secondary damage. We’ll use powerful pumps and wet vacuums to remove water from carpets, floors, and other surfaces.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use specialized equipment to dry your office building, including dehumidifiers and air movers. This will help prevent mold growth and ensure a safe and healthy environment for employees and customers.
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fecting
Our team will thoroughly clean and disinfect your office building, removing any remaining water and debris. We’ll use eco-friendly cleaning products and techniques to ensure a safe and healthy environment.
Step 5: Restoration and Reconstruction
Once the drying and cleaning process is complete, our team will begin the restoration and reconstruction process. We’ll repair or replace damaged materials, including walls, floors, and ceilings.

Warning Signs You Need Office Building Water Damage Restoration
Catching water damage early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ent potential health hazards. Keep an eye out for these warning signs: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ors can show mold growth or water damage. Don’t ignore these odors, they can spread quickly and cause serious health issues.
Water Stains or Warping on Ceilings or Walls
Water stains or warping on ceilings or walls can show a leak or water damage. Don’t wait, call our team to assess the damage and prevent further damage.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can show water damage or moisture issues. Don’t ignore these signs, they can lead to costly repairs and health hazards.
Unusual Sounds or Leaks
Unusual sounds or leaks can show a problem with your office building’s plumbing or roof. Don’t wait, call our team to assess the damage and prevent further damage.
Mold or Mildew Growth
Mold or mildew growth can show a serious health hazard. Don’t ignore these signs, call our team to assess the damage and prevent further damage.

Office Building Water Damage Restoration Cost In Buchanan, GA
The cost of Office Building Water Damage Restoration in Buchanan, GA can vary dep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| The size of the affected area, type of flooring, and amount of water present.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| The size of the affected area, type of flooring, and amount of water present. |
| Cleaning and Disinfecting | $500 – $2,000 | The size of the affected area, type of surfaces, and amount of debris present. |
| Restoration and Reconstruction | $2,000 – $10,000 | The size of the affected area, type of materials, and amount of labor required. |
| Inspection and Testing | $200 – $1,000 | The size of the affected area, type of testing required, and amount of labor involved. |
| Permitting and Inspection Fees | $500 – $2,000 | The type of permit required, size of the affected area, and amount of labor involved. |
